Loss of Feeling (1935) is a Fantasy / Science Fiction / Drama film directed by Aleksandr Andriyevsky, starring Sergei Vecheslov, Vladimir Gardin, Maria Volgina.

In an unnamed English-speaking capitalist land, a young engineer invents inexhaustible giant robots to replace the fragile human workers on high-volume assembly-lines, and soon finds his invention co-opted by the military-industrial complex.
